Industry Examples of Cases (Retail)
Common products and services typical of NAICS Code 458320-01, illustrating the main business activities and contributions to the market.
- Laptop cases
- Camera cases
- Phone cases
- Briefcases
- Gun cases
- Musical instrument cases
- Tool cases
- Makeup cases
- Jewelry cases
- Watch cases
- Gaming console cases
- Drone cases
- Medical equipment cases
- Sports equipment cases
- Fishing tackle cases
- Art supply cases
History
A concise historical narrative of NAICS Code 458320-01 covering global milestones and recent developments within the United States.
- The "Cases (Retail)" industry has a long history dating back to ancient times when people used animal skins to carry their belongings. In the 19th century, the first modern luggage was introduced, and by the 20th century, the industry had grown significantly with the introduction of new materials such as plastic and aluminum. In recent years, the industry has seen a shift towards more sustainable and eco-friendly materials, with companies like Patagonia and Tumi leading the way. In the United States, the industry has been impacted by the COVID-19 pandemic, with many retailers experiencing a decline in sales due to reduced travel and tourism. However, the industry has also seen an increase in demand for products like laptop cases and backpacks as more people work from home.
